This can lower a temperature. You can buy paracetamol in liquid form for children. It comes in various brand names. The dose for each age is given with the medicine packet. Note: paracetamol does not treat the cause of the fever. It merely helps to ease discomfort. It also eases headaches, and …

WebIf you or your child are taking liquid flucloxacillin, it will usually be made up for you by your pharmacist. The medicine will come with a syringe or spoon to help you take the right amount. If you do not have a syringe or spoon, ask your pharmacist for one. Do not use a kitchen teaspoon because it will not measure the right amount.
